Bernie Sanders will build a strong middle class
Jenny Arnold
Jan. 10, 2016 10:22 am
To the editor:
Bernie Sanders is a strong advocate for middle class union workers.
Unions are the essence of the middle class. They provide equal pay among your male and female counterparts, health benefits, paid vacation and sick, safe working conditions and the right to bargain. Unfortunately, private sector jobs usually don't provide unions for their employees, therefore working longer hours for little pay, poor working conditions, no paid vacation, sick and maternity leave.
Sanders has stood by union workers since his time as mayor of Burlington, Vt., in the 1980s. He has joined picket lines on many occasions and stood on the Senate floor to back bills to help increase the right of workers to join unions.
Sanders stated that the middle class was the envy of the world 40 years ago, but now faces a decline. In order to strengthen the middle class we have to restore workers rights to bargain for better wages, benefits and working conditions. Sanders has proved himself to be the best Democrat to build a stronger middle class and for workers to have the ability to join unions in private sector jobs without backlash from their employer.
